Outcome and prognosis in retroperitoneal soft tissue sarcoma

Summary
Complete surgical removal is key for retroperitoneal soft tissue sarcoma (RSTS) survival. While adjuvant irradiation may delay local recurrence, new strategies are needed for improved outcomes in RSTS patients.

Background:
- Retroperitoneal soft tissue sarcomas (RSTS) are rare and challenging malignancies.
- Treatment outcomes for RSTS have historically been limited, with local control being a significant challenge.
Purpose of the Study:
- To retrospectively evaluate treatment outcomes for patients with RSTS.
- To identify prognostic factors for survival, locoregional disease control, and distant metastasis in RSTS.
Main Methods:
- Retrospective review of 104 RSTS patients treated with surgery and irradiation (1975-1988).
- Univariate log-rank analysis to assess prognostic factors.
- Evaluation of surgical completeness, adjuvant radiotherapy, chemotherapy, histology, and patient demographics.
Main Results:
- Complete surgical excision was the only significant factor improving survival and disease control (locoregional and distant).
- Liposarcoma histology and younger age (<62 years) were associated with improved survival.
- Adjuvant irradiation after complete surgery showed a trend towards prolonged locoregional relapse-free survival (RFR).
Conclusions:
- Failure in local control is the primary driver of treatment failure in RSTS.
- Postoperative irradiation, even at doses >35 Gy, only delayed local recurrence after complete surgery.
- Novel treatment strategies, such as preoperative irradiation combined with aggressive surgical excision, are warranted for RSTS.
